description
Medway Council wants a Medway Assessment and Support Service (MASS) to provide an intensive assessment service and support with available temporary accommodation provision for people experiencing rough sleeping and/or who have complex needs in Medway. The service will need to provide access to a space with facilities as laid out in Schedule 1, with targeted assessment and support to rough sleepers for a period of 1 to 2 weeks. With an accommodation option with basic provision for up to 5 people allowing for those being assessed to stay and for an additional 5 people who may be identified as requiring longer engagement/assessment/support. The overall aim is to impact positively on the number of rough sleepers on the streets of Medway who are not able to make use of widely available routes into services and/or accommodation, and who have not been able to access supported accommodation through the traditional routes.
The service must include methods of engaging people with complex and multiple needs who may be reluctant to accept help in getting to a single service offer within 1 to 2 weeks. This will require very robust engagement strategies from the provider, who will be expected to work in close partnership with other statutory and voluntary agencies as applicable.
